Post by: BlooM on March 29, 2009, 02:13:22 pm
maybe this is wat you had in mind.
removed some parts of the meshgroup.
Also deleted the parts in the shape file/meshfile and some txmt's.
Also deleted a link in the gmdn file.
If it doesn't work anymore, then i made a mistake.
You then should extract the gmdc and simply import(switch) it in your previous package.
